    Gloworm Ultracom 30CXI

    Just some feed back - there are 2 grey taps on the ultracom cxi for the inbuilt filling loop. The plastic taps were rounded off and not closing the valve fully so removed the taps and cycled the valves a couple of times with a large slotted screwdriver. The pressure has been steady since.
